Are there local banks in Emerson that offer safe deposit boxes, and what is the typical process for renting one?

Yes, the brick-and-mortar branches in Emerson, specifically Great Western Bank and First Interstate Bank, offer safe deposit boxes for rent. Availability can vary based on box size (small, medium, large), and there may be a waiting list for the most popular sizes. The process involves visiting the branch in person with a valid ID, filling out a rental agreement, and receiving a unique key. You will be the only person with access to your box, and rental fees are typically charged annually to your bank account.

When evaluating your "banks near me" in Emerson, don't just look at the name on the building. Step inside or call them. Ask specific questions: What are the monthly fees, and how can they be waived? Do they offer free checking with low minimum balances? What are their current rates on savings accounts or CDs? Inquire about their online and mobile banking capabilities—a crucial feature for managing your money efficiently, even if you also appreciate in-person service. Furthermore, if you're a small business owner or farmer, ask about specialized lending officers or agricultural banking programs.
